| Paid $700 for mine. Sounds like the starter seal is out, not hard to change. Might want to check filter for the COM, This gets plugged and the tractor doesn"t move. Chances are,it has a trans problem causing it not to move. try going into high range. if you here a rattling noise when you let out the clutch. It means the transmision range selector is between gears. This is a common problem with the 800"s. Might have to play with it. best try low range that is the easyest range to find |
